What to Expect in Your Preliminary Solar Consultation
What should one expect during an initial solar consultation? This appointment serves as an entry point to the world of solar energy and its potential advantages for homeowners. Typically, a solar consultant will first begin a discussion about the homeowner's driving factors for exploring solar energy. They will present the various solar technologies available, including photovoltaic panels and solar thermal systems, while explaining the mechanics of how these systems perform.
Subsequently, the consultant may present an overview of the solar installation process, including timelines and potential financial incentives such as tax credits and rebates. Additionally, they will address common questions about system maintenance and warranties. The session could also involve a preliminary evaluation of the homeowner's current energy bills to provide context for future energy savings. Ultimately, the initial consultation aims to educate homeowners and help them make well-informed decisions about their solar energy choices.
Assessing Your Property's Solar Potential and Energy Needs
After obtaining an understanding of solar technologies and the installation process during the initial consultation, homeowners should focus on analyzing their property's solar potential and energy requirements. This analysis involves reviewing factors such as roof orientation, shading from nearby trees or buildings, and the overall size of the roof. Ideal solar potential typically calls for a south-facing roof with minimal obstacles.
Furthermore, homeowners should assess their energy consumption habits. Assessing past utility bills can provide insights into peak usage times and overall energy demand. Understanding these patterns enables determine the system size necessary to meet energy requirements effectively.
Property owners may also examine seasonal variations in sunlight exposure and local climate conditions, as these elements can affect solar efficiency. By carefully assessing these aspects, homeowners can ensure that their solar installation matches their energy requirements and maximizes the benefits of solar technology.

Evaluate Energy Consumption
How might homeowners accurately determine their energy demands before installing solar panels? First, they should analyze their prior electricity bills, examining usage patterns over the previous year to pinpoint peak months and general consumption trends. This data helps them estimate their average monthly usage in kilowatt-hours (kWh). After that, homeowners need to consider their lifestyle and future energy demands, such as expanding families or new electric appliances. Speaking to a solar energy consultant can also deliver insights into the ideal system size, as they can examine energy efficiency measures and local regulations. By completing these steps, homeowners can make knowledgeable decisions about the solar panel system that will best meet their energy demands while increasing savings and sustainability.
Evaluate Rooftop Area
Assessing roof space is a critical step get going for homeowners planning solar panel installation, as it directly affects the system's efficiency and overall output. Homeowners must evaluate several factors, including roof orientation, slope, and shading from surrounding structures or trees. South-facing roofs typically receive the most sunlight, making them perfect for solar panels. Additionally, the available square footage will determine how many panels can be installed, impacting energy production. An inspection of the roof's condition is also essential, as any repairs needed should be addressed before installation. By conducting a thorough evaluation, homeowners can ensure they select a solar panel system that maximizes energy generation and aligns with their energy needs and budget.
Grasping Solar Installation Permitting Requirements and Regulations
Handling the landscape of solar installation permits and regulations can often leave homeowners and contractors wondering about the necessary steps to guarantee compliance. Multiple local, state, and federal regulations govern solar panel installations, which can vary considerably by location. Property owners must typically secure electrical permits, building permits, and occasionally zoning approvals before moving forward.
Furthermore, some jurisdictions may enforce specific codes concerning the installation process, such as safety standards or structural assessments. It is critical for homeowners to become aware of these requirements, as failure to get the necessary permits can bring about fines or the removal of installed systems.
Working with local authorities or consulting with experienced solar professionals can give clarity on the specific regulations pertaining to individual projects. Understanding these regulations not only ensures compliance but also facilitates a more seamless installation process, ultimately leading to the successful implementation of solar energy systems.

Pre-Installation Site Assessment
Prior to the implementation of solar panels can begin, a detailed site assessment is necessary to guarantee maximum performance and safety. During this assessment, specialists analyze the property's roof structure, orientation, and shading from adjacent trees or buildings. They examine the electrical system's compatibility and establish the best placement for the solar panels to maximize sunlight exposure. Moreover, any local zoning laws or permitting requirements are assessed to verify compliance. The assessment may also include an examination of the homeowner's energy consumption patterns, offering insights into potential savings. This comprehensive analysis allows installers to design a customized solar solution tailored to the specific needs of the property, eventually resulting in a more productive and reliable solar energy system.
The Installation Day Process
On the day of installation, homeowners should expect a smoothly coordinated process that typically unfolds over several hours. The installation team typically arrives early, bringing along the essential equipment and materials. First, they examine the roof and guarantee safety measures are in place. Next, they start installing the solar panels, then proceed with the installation of wiring and inverters. All through the day, the team will provide updates on progress and any necessary modifications needed. Once the panels are firmly in place, they will connect the system to the electrical grid. To conclude, a thorough inspection ensures everything is functioning properly. Homeowners can anticipate a clean work area as the team finishes up, leaving them with an optimized solar energy system ready to operate.
After Installation Maintenance Advice
While the installation of solar panels is a significant milestone, comprehending the essential post-installation maintenance is crucial for guaranteeing peak performance. Regular inspections are vital; homeowners should inspect for debris, dust, or shading that may reduce efficiency. Cleaning the panels, preferably twice a year, can increase energy output, especially in locations with heavy pollen or pollution. Monitoring the system's performance through a dedicated app or inverter display is advisable for spotting potential issues early. Furthermore, it is prudent to schedule professional maintenance every few years to evaluate system integrity and functionality. Keeping warranty information readily available and staying informed about local regulations can also assist in maintaining optimal operation and longevity of the solar panel system.
Connecting Your Solar Panel Setup to the Grid
Connecting a solar panel setup to the electrical grid is a vital step that allows homeowners to optimize their energy efficiency and possibly earn credits through net metering. This process usually requires the installation of an inverter, which converts the direct current (DC) produced by the solar panels into alternating current (AC) appropriate for home use and grid compatibility.
Once the inverter is set up, a connection to the local utility grid is established, usually requiring inspection and approval from the utility company. This ensures that the system complies with safety standards and adheres to local regulations. After approval, a bi-directional meter may be installed to track energy consumption and production. If the solar panels create more energy than the household uses, excess energy can be sent back to the grid, enabling homeowners to receive credits on their utility bills. This connection not only enhances sustainability but also provides potential cost savings.
Keeping Your Solar Panels Running Efficiently: Maintenance Advice
After establishing a connection to the grid, upholding solar panels is essential for maintaining their long-term functionality. Routine cleaning is critical, as debris, dust, and dirt can accumulate on the panels, blocking sunlight absorption. Homeowners should aim to clean their panels at least two times annually, or more often in dusty environments. Additionally, examining the panels for harm, such as loose connections or cracks, should be part of routine maintenance, preferably performed yearly by a professional. Observing the system's performance through the inverter can help pinpoint any declines in energy production, necessitating timely intervention. Furthermore, keeping surrounding trees pruned to avoid shading will optimize exposure to sunlight. By following these maintenance tips, homeowners can enhance the lifespan and performance of their solar panel systems, confirming they continue to supply clean energy effectively.

How Long Can Solar Panels Be Expected to Last?
Solar panel systems usually last between 25 to 30 years, contingent upon the quality and maintenance. Most manufacturers provide warranties covering defects and performance for approximately 20 to 25 years, guaranteeing long-term reliability and efficiency.
Am I Able to Install Solar Panels on My Own?
You can install solar panels yourself, but it necessitates considerable knowledge of electrical systems, local regulations, and safety standards. The majority of professionals suggest hiring qualified technicians to secure correct installation and optimal efficiency of the solar energy system.
